Split Rail Fence Replacement Questions
What are split rail fences typically made of? They are usually constructed from wood, such as cedar or pine, for durability and classic appearance.
Can split rail fences be used for property boundaries? Yes, they are commonly used to define property lines and create open, rustic boundaries.
Are split rail fences suitable for livestock containment? They can be used for light livestock or horses, but may require additional reinforcement for larger animals.
What signs indicate a split rail fence needs replacement? Visible rotting, broken rails, leaning posts, or significant weather damage are common indicators.
